Yes on Measure Z Campaign Kick-Off
Monterey County Fracking Ban Proponents to Host Rally and Grand Opening of New HQ
The official campaign kick-off party for Yes on Measure Z, to ban fracking in Monterey County, will be held in Salinas on Saturday, September 10. A rally will be held in addition to the grand opening of the campaign's new headquarters, which is located in the heart of Salinas on Main Street.
Measure Z made it to the November ballot as the result of months of work by volunteers with Protect Monterey County, a group working to safe-guard local water supplies and protect the county's agricultural production, in order to assure a healthy future for Central Coast families.
